5 Replacing the negative values in the data frame with NA and 0 values. See Also. The sub () function (short for substitute) in R searches for a pattern in text and replaces this pattern with replacement text. Mutate function can either create new variables or replace values from existing ones. I have published several other tutorials about related topics such as extracting data and character strings. Subscribe to my free statistics newsletter. Details. from: character string naming the column with the patterns you would like to replace. sub ("y", "NEW", x) # Applying sub # "xxxxNEWxxyxaaaaaay". I am practising some R skills on some dummy data. mapvalues to replace values with vectors of any type . FindReplace allows you to find and replace multiple character string patterns in a data frame's column. By accepting you will be accessing content from YouTube, a service provided by an external third party. Sounds nuts but there is a point to it! If data is a vector, replace takes a single value. For example, if we want to replace all cases of -99 in our dataset, we write: df %>% replace_with_na_all(condition = ~.x == -99) #> # A tibble: 5 x 4 #> name x y z #> #> 1 N/A 1 N/A -100 #> 2 N A 3 NOt … Examples Required fields are marked *. str_replace(x, "y", "NEW") # Applying str_replace x # Print character string The third parameter is the character to replace any matching characters with. Now, we can apply the str_replace_all function of the stringr package to replace all occurrences of the letter y. str_replace_all(x, "y", "NEW") # Applying str_replace_all 12:00 PM editing, grel, remove, replace. © Copyright Statistics Globe – Legal Notice & Privacy Policy, Example 1: Replace All Occurrences of Specific Character in String, Example 2: Replace First Occurrence of Specific Character in String, Example 3: Replace All Occurrences Using str_replace_all Function of stringr Package, Example 4: Replace First Occurrence Using str_replace Function of stringr Package. Select column with column name in R dplyr. tidyr’s separate function is the best option to separate a column or split a column of text the way you want. Suppose you have the sentence He is a wolf in cheap clothing, which is clearly a mistake. Do NOT follow this link or you will be banned from the site. Column names of an R Dataframe can be acessed using the function colnames (). 3 Replace the NA values with 0’s using replace () in R. 4 Replace the NA values with the mean of the values. The short theoretical explanation of the function is the following: sub (old_value, new_value, string) The previous output is exactly the same as in Example 1.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python packages. # "xxxxyxxyxaaaaaay". str_replace() function of “stringr” package is used to replace the first occurrence of the column in R, str_replace_all() function of “stringr” package is used to replace all the occurrence of the column in R. (adsbygoogle = window.adsbygoogle || []).push({}); DataScience Made Simple © 2021. For this, we can use the gsub function as shown below: gsub("y", "NEW", x) # Applying gsub Replace the values in column s1 to s35 by 3 if the value of cell 4 and b 0 if it is not. Select column which starts with or ends with certain character. Pandas is one of those packages that makes importing and analyzing data much easier.. Pandas Series.str.replace() method works like Python.replace() method only, but it works on Series too. The stringr package is a powerful add-on package for the manipulation of character strings in R. For that reason, I want to show in Examples 3 and 4, how to use the functions of the stringr package to replace certain characters in strings. I have a data.frame with 2 columns of strings. To replace the complete string with NA, use replacement = NA_character_. # "xxxxNEWxxyxaaaaaay". One contains the patterns to replace and the other contains their replacement. Article in the data frame with NA and 0 values that the function starts with,... Numeric, character, and follows the rules for rlang ’ s expression of simple functions clothing, which clearly. Content from YouTube, a service provided by an external third party we to! Be banned from the site editing, grel, remove, replace takes a single value from! A little different, and factors columns are characters, and when referencing a variable, you may out. In statistical analysis with an example Statistics tutorials as well as codes in and... Syntax here is a little different, and factors in our character string patterns in a given in. As in r replace character in column 1 column like the sign # before some number fastest way to replace in! Whose value is unknown, offers & news at Statistics Globe this article illustrates to! To it s separate function is the character pattern NEW choice will be banned from site... Need more info on the latest tutorials, offers & news at Statistics Globe to the output of colnames )! Time, the output of colnames ( ) more info on the examples of using tidyr ’ s separate is. And when referencing a variable, you may opt out anytime: Policy. Editing, grel, remove, replace be of class character or factor article! Y in our character string # `` xxxxNEWxxyxaaaaaay '' not follow this link you. Youtube cookies to play this video given string in the video, you use.x special character with?! C ( pattern1 = replacement1 ) ) to str_replace_all within a string in comments. Print character string naming the column with the argument na.rm = TRUE questions and/or.... More info on the latest tutorials, offers & news at Statistics.! Which starts with ~, and when referencing a variable, you may out! Some numeric columns, i provide Statistics tutorials as well as codes in R, we use function! A string in R programming language: Privacy Policy programming and Python language for data. Exchange only the first occurrence of the fantastic ecosystem of data-centric Python packages, service... To str_replace_all: a data frame with NA, use case_when ( ) stands for global )! A pattern when referencing a variable, you may opt out anytime Privacy. Names using an index to the output of colnames ( ) stands for global )... More info on the examples of using tidyr ’ s expression of simple functions to get updates on the of! This link or you will be banned from the site element of string, pass a named (. Characters that aren ’ t forget to subscribe to my email newsletter in order to get updates NEW. Accessing content from YouTube, a service provided by an external third party step 2 ) we. Characters in strings in R programming and Python to compute of the other articles on my homepage expression simple. Access the individual column names using an index to the output of colnames ( ) like. To get updates on NEW articles NEW variables or replace values from existing ones, factors... Tutorials as well as codes in R with an example, character, and factors, x ) Applying..., i provide Statistics tutorials as well as codes in R with an example string! Rlang ’ s see how to replace any matching characters with '' ) # str_replace! Let us see some simple examples of this article in the R programming.... Expression of simple functions get regular updates on the examples of this page, you may opt out:. Character with space video of my YouTube channel a point to it second and third are! Xxxxnewxxyxaaaaaay '' the pattern and its replacement must be of class character or factor complete string with NA use. Specific values in the data frame 's column questions and/or comments first occurrence of the fantastic ecosystem of Python! A variable, you may opt out anytime: Privacy Policy be content. Complicated criteria, use replacement = NA_character_, primarily because of the mean with the to! Any type are characters, and the page will refresh use the sub function exchange. To use the sub function to exchange a certain character pattern within a string the! Ends with certain character be banned from the site each element of string, r replace character in column a vector! My homepage this is an S3 generic: dplyr provides methods for numeric, the and... And its replacement must be of class character or factor and its replacement must in. Replaces all characters that aren ’ t forget to r replace character in column to my email newsletter in order get... Methods for numeric, the second and third columns are characters, and follows the for. Aren ’ t numbers or letters with a zero-length string methods for numeric character! Existing ones here is a point to it rules for rlang ’ s separate.! Video, you may opt out anytime: Privacy Policy and b 0 if it is.... From YouTube, a service provided by an external third party each special character with space t to., which is clearly a mistake str_replace # `` xxxxyxxyxaaaaaay '' ’ ll show how to replace the... Simple examples of this page, you may opt out anytime: Privacy Policy, because! Need to compute of the other articles on my homepage you want (! Shows how to replace and the fourth column is a factor to a. In gsub ( ) in R. 2 replace a value or matches a pattern by position! 5 Replacing the negative values in a given string in the data frame with numeric..., use replacement = NA_character_ patterns in a given string in R with an.! Tidyr ’ s see how to replace any matching characters with programming and Python row has a value. Time, the second and third columns are characters, and the articles. An external third party let ’ s separate function is the fastest way to replace any matching characters.... ( c ( pattern1 = replacement1 ) ) to str_replace_all like an array case_when ( ) R.! Forget to subscribe to my email newsletter in order to get updates on NEW articles of! Some of the other articles on my homepage to get updates on examples. 3 if the value of cell 4 and b 0 if it r replace character in column not want... Example 1 like the sign # before some number sentence He is a point it. My homepage # create example character string naming the column with the argument na.rm = TRUE fastest way to any... Do not follow this link or you will be saved and the fourth column is numeric, second... New articles ) to str_replace_all s1 to s35 by 3 if the value of cell 4 and b if. Of colnames ( ) video: Please accept YouTube cookies to play this.! Mean with the patterns you would like to replace values with vectors of any type we str_replace! Xxxxnewxxyxaaaaaay '': the pattern and its replacement must be in the vector party! = replacement1 ) ) to str_replace_all provides methods for numeric, the output is exactly the same as in 1. Statistical analysis 1 Syntax of replace ( ) in R. 2 replace a value or matches a pattern compute. Exchange a certain character email newsletter in order to get updates on examples... Accept YouTube cookies to play this video t forget to subscribe to my newsletter... In a data frame with at least two columns output is exactly the same as in example 1 of YouTube... Editing, grel, remove, replace example, i provide Statistics tutorials as well as codes in R.... Character column of text the way you want step 2 ) Now we need to compute of other! In gsub ( ) just like an array articles on my homepage have the sentence He is a,. A wolf in cheap clothing, which is clearly a mistake the page will refresh summary: article! Columns are characters, and the page will refresh just like an array show the of! Topics such as extracting data and character strings primarily because of the fantastic of... As extracting data and character strings ’ ll show how to exchange certain! Have a data frame with at least two columns, offers & news at Statistics Globe mutate can... In this example replaces all characters that aren ’ t forget to subscribe my... Vectors of any type more complicated criteria, use replacement = NA_character_ and replace multiple character string #! ’ s expression of simple functions content from YouTube, a service provided by an external third.! Same as in example 1 see how to replace the values in a very large set. And b 0 if it is not second and third columns are characters and! Youtube cookies to play this video xxxxNEWxxyxaaaaaay '' in column s1 to s35 by 3 if the of! The sentence He is a vector, replace by 3 if the value cell. With vectors of any type multiple character string x # Print character string naming the column with the argument =. The g in gsub ( ) aren ’ t forget to subscribe to my email newsletter in order get... And when referencing a variable, you may have a data frame with NA and 0 values character... Two columns as extracting data and character strings dplyr ; select column which starts with ~ and... Topics such as extracting data and character strings sub function to exchange only the first occurrence of the letter by.

r replace character in column 2021